If you are currently on EI (Employment Insurance), have been on regular EI in the last 3 years, or parental EI in the last 5 years, you may be eligible to apply for the Skills Development Program.
Skills Development Program - This program provides funding for people to get skills training to help them re-enter the job market.
Feepayer (Skills Development) Program - This program allows participants to take formal training while they receive their Employment Insurance benefits. All school costs are covered by the participants.
Targeted Wage Subsidy Program - This program encourages employers to hire and train participants who would not normally be hired due to a lack of work experience, to fill an existing job.
